Hanna Jaakola is a skilled entrepreneur, facilitator, and educator with over ten years of experience in co-designing and training processes both online and offline. She is passionate about helping individuals create a more empathetic and meaningful world, listening, empathizing, and supporting them as they achieve their goals. Hanna is a compassionate and creative coach, who uses design thinking to train individuals to develop their creativity, problem-solving skills, and efficiency through workshops and one-on-one coaching. She has a particular talent for graphics and presentation design, creating Powerpoint presentations, and survey forms.
Hanna's educational background spans a broad range of disciplines, including Neuro Linguistic Programming, Brain-Based Coaching, Compassionate Communication, and marketing. She holds an MBA in Service Innovation and Design from Laurea University of Applied Sciences and a BSc in Economics and Business Administration, Marketing from the University of Oulu. Additionally, she has worked in several research and project-based roles, such as a Researcher at Ellun Kanat and a Project Manager at Laurea University.
One of her current focuses is developing the TyöhyvinvointiMuotoilu concept for Laurea University – a business-oriented concept that aims to optimize job satisfaction through design-centered workshops. Hanna values creativity and self-awareness and is currently facilitating creativity and self-awareness groups as part of her Taideterapeuttinen ryhmänohjaaja training. She is also coaching and facilitating virtual sessions for "RESU" and "PATU," two programs that empower businesspeople to become more resourceful and innovative.
